About The Position

The PRN Nurse Examiner RN or APRN will perform Sexual Assault Victim Examinations on victims/survivors of sexual violence crimes. Throughout the exam, the incumbent provides sensitivity and understanding to promote recovery and healing for victims of sexual violence. This role requires participation in a 24-hour on-call rotation and maintaining a thorough and accurate medical record on each client examined in accordance with SAVE program protocol. The position also involves providing medical advice and referrals, attending meetings, and potentially performing aftercare exams. The role emphasizes maintaining good working relationships with community professionals and colleagues, upholding ethical behavior, and adhering to all Suncoast Center, Inc. policies.
